Advancements in AI Technology
Artificial Intelligence (AI) is evolving rapidly, and its advancements are reshaping various aspects of our lives. One significant development is that AI robots can now learn by observing human actions. The highest-performing AI systems can generate high-quality images based on complex textual descriptions, showcasing their ability to understand and interpret language. The amount of computation used to train these advanced systems has increased exponentially over the last decade, reflecting the growing complexity and capability of AI technologies.
Investment in AI has surged, with funding in 2021 being about 30 times larger than a decade earlier, indicating a substantial commitment to AI development. Companies like Google are at the forefront of this progress, introducing innovations such as ALOHA Unleashed, which enables robots to learn tasks like tying shoelaces and cleaning kitchens. They have also developed AlphaChip and Willow, advanced chips that significantly enhance computational efficiency.
Impacts of AI on Various Sectors
AI’s influence extends across multiple sectors, transforming how businesses operate and interact with customers. In the beer brewing industry, for instance, companies like IntelligentX are using AI to incorporate customer feedback into the brewing process, enhancing both customer experience and operational efficiency (Koombea).
In cybersecurity, AI plays a crucial role in improving threat detection and incident response. Companies like Palo Alto Networks and Alphabet have introduced AI solutions such as Magnifier and Chronicle to bolster overall cybersecurity measures (Koombea).
However, the rise of AI also brings concerns about job displacement. According to a 2020 World Economic Forum report, AI could replace as many as 85 million jobs worldwide by 2025. Both blue-collar and white-collar jobs that involve straightforward and repetitive tasks are at risk. This includes roles such as drivers, factory workers, administrative assistants, paralegals, and some copywriters.
On the flip side, the demand for human workers to train and develop AI systems is expected to grow. New job roles such as machine learning engineers, AI ethics specialists, and AI and cybersecurity researchers will emerge as AI continues to advance (Built In).

Potential Dangers of AI
The rapid and unpredictable progression of AI capabilities raises significant concerns. Experts suggest that AI may soon rival the immense power of nuclear weapons, necessitating immediate and proactive measures to mitigate these risks. Here are some of the potential dangers associated with AI:
Danger | Description |
---|---|
Lethal Autonomous Weapons | AI-driven systems capable of identifying and executing targets without human intervention. The Kargu 2 drone in Libya marked the first reported use of such a weapon in 2020. |
Biological Threats | The cost of gene synthesis has dramatically decreased, allowing rogue actors to create new biological agents while bypassing traditional safety screenings. |
Chemical Warfare | In 2022, researchers repurposed a medical research AI system to produce toxic molecules, generating 40,000 potential chemical warfare agents in just a few hours. |
Rogue AIs | Malicious actors could intentionally create rogue AIs with dangerous goals, leading to catastrophic outcomes. |
These dangers highlight the need for careful consideration and regulation of AI technologies to prevent misuse and unintended consequences.
Social and Ethical Implications
The rise of AI also brings forth various social and ethical implications that you should be aware of. As AI systems become more integrated into daily life, they can impact employment, privacy, and decision-making processes. Here are some key considerations:
Implication | Description |
---|---|
Job Displacement | Automation through AI may lead to job losses in various sectors, raising concerns about economic inequality and workforce displacement. |
Privacy Concerns | AI systems often rely on vast amounts of data, which can lead to privacy violations and misuse of personal information. |
Bias and Discrimination | AI algorithms can perpetuate existing biases, leading to unfair treatment of certain groups in areas like hiring, lending, and law enforcement. |
Accountability | As AI systems make more decisions, questions arise about who is responsible for their actions, especially in cases of harm or error. |
